aNine trials carried out two methods of analysis, two trials carried out three methods and one trial carried out four methods. bNumber of trials reporting some form of nonadherence (98) is used as denominator for %. cAdherence thresholds used were 60%, 2/3, 75%, 80% and 90%. dAdherence thresholds used were 2/3 and 5/6. eCensoring times: time of starting disallowed intervention, when participants reported taking less than 2/3 of their medication in the past year, when received treatment out of trial, or censored following six-month lag after receiving less than 80% of drug. fCensored when received <80% of drug, weighted by the inverse probability of each participant’s estimated adherence probability. gAnalysis split into two groups (according to whether participants had taken more or less than 50% of the prescribed medication) in one trial and into three groups (according to the proportion (>90%, 75-90% or <75%) of their time at risk that they were supplied with drug) in other trial. hIncluded if received at least one dose of treatment. ITT: intention to treat; PP: per protocol.
